Why This Matters
Malnutrition was common and much more frequent during active Crohn's disease in this Bangladeshi cohort, highlighting the need for routine nutritional assessment in IBD care. Simple anthropometric measures helped detect tissue depletion, while some blood tests were influenced by inflammation.

Study Snapshot
What To Know
This study compared 63 patients with active Crohn's disease to 64 in remission using CDAI, endoscopy (SES-CD), and MRE. Nutritional status was assessed with BMI, MUAC, calf circumference, triceps skinfold, mid-arm muscle circumference, the Mini Nutritional Assessment, and blood tests (hemoglobin, iron, albumin, zinc, folate, B12).
Participants with active disease had lower anthropometric measures (BMI, MUAC, calf circumference, TSF, MAMC) and lower hemoglobin, serum iron, albumin, and zinc. The authors note that albumin and zinc can be depressed by inflammation as well as by poor nutrition, so combining anthropometry with targeted biochemical tests gives a fuller picture.
Keep In Mind
Cross-sectional design limits causal inference. Albumin and zinc can be low due to inflammation as well as poor nutrition. The study population was South Asian adults at a single tertiary center, which may limit generalizability.
